当前位置:首页 > 程序系统 > 正文内容

java编程教程下载,Java编程教程大全下载合集

本教程提供Java编程学习资源下载,涵盖从基础语法到高级应用的全套课程,内容包括Java开发环境搭建、基本数据类型、面向对象编程、异常处理、集合框架等核心知识点,下载教程后,您可以跟随视频讲解和实践项目,逐步提升Java编程技能,教程适用于初学者和有一定基础的程序员,助您快速掌握Java编程语言。

Java编程教程下载——新手入门必备指南**

大家好,我是编程新手小王,最近在学Java编程,但总是觉得找不到合适的教程,今天我就来分享一下我自己的经验,希望能帮助到同样困惑的朋友们。

Java编程教程下载的重要性

java编程教程下载
  1. 系统学习:下载一套完整的Java编程教程可以帮助我们系统地学习Java基础知识,避免零散学习导致的知识点遗漏。
  2. 方便复习:下载的教程可以随时查看,方便我们在学习过程中复习和巩固。
  3. 节省时间:通过下载教程,我们可以避免在网上搜索相关资料,节省大量时间。

Java编程教程下载的途径

  1. 官方文档:Java官方文档(https://docs.oracle.com/javase/)提供了最权威的Java教程,适合初学者和进阶者。
  2. 在线教程网站:如慕课网(imooc.com)、极客学院(jikexueyuan.com)等,这些网站提供了丰富的Java教程,包括视频和文档。
  3. GitHub:GitHub上有很多优秀的Java教程项目,可以免费下载和使用。

Java编程教程下载的选择

  1. 适合自己水平的教程:选择适合自己的教程非常重要,过高或过低的难度都会影响学习效果,全面**:教程应包含Java编程的各个方面,如基础语法、面向对象编程、集合框架、多线程等。
  2. 更新及时:选择更新及时的教程,确保学习到的知识是最新的。

Java编程教程下载后的学习建议

  1. 制定学习计划:根据自己的时间安排,制定一个合理的学习计划,并严格执行。
  2. 动手实践:学习编程不能只看教程,要动手实践,多写代码。
  3. 加入学习群组:加入Java学习群组,与其他学习者交流心得,共同进步。

Java编程教程下载的注意事项

  1. 版权问题:下载教程时要注意版权问题,尽量选择合法渠道。
  2. 病毒风险:下载教程时要注意防范病毒,可以使用杀毒软件进行扫描。
  3. 个人隐私:在下载教程时,要注意保护个人隐私,避免泄露个人信息。

Java编程教程下载是学习Java编程的重要途径,希望大家能根据自己的需求,选择合适的教程,并坚持学习,早日成为一名优秀的Java程序员。

java编程教程下载

其他相关扩展阅读资料参考文献:

  1. 选择适合的Java教程资源

    1. 明确学习目标:初学者应优先选择系统化入门教程,如《Java从零开始》或《Java核心技术》;进阶者可关注框架与实战类资源,如Spring Boot或Android开发教程。
    2. 质量:选择权威平台发布的教程,如Oracle官方文档、JavaRanch社区或知名博主的博客文章,避免低质量或过时的资源。
    3. 适配学习方式:根据个人偏好选择文字教程视频课程交互式平台,例如B站、慕课网或Codecademy,确保学习效率。
  2. 主流Java教程下载平台推荐

    1. 官方渠道:Oracle官网提供免费Java SE教程,涵盖基础语法、JVM原理等,适合建立扎实的理论基础。
    2. 开源社区:GitHub上可搜索到大量开源项目文档,例如Spring框架的官方示例代码,通过阅读源码理解实际应用。
    3. 视频平台:B站和YouTube提供免费高质量视频教程,如“尚硅谷Java基础”系列,适合视觉学习者快速掌握核心概念。
    4. 专业网站:菜鸟教程、W3Schools等平台提供简洁易懂的代码示例,适合快速查阅和练习。
    5. 书籍资源:《Effective Java》《Java并发编程实战》等经典书籍可通过电子书或PDF格式下载,适合深入学习。
  3. 高效学习Java的实践方法

    1. 项目驱动学习:通过实际项目(如开发一个简单的计算器或数据库管理系统)应用所学知识,避免只看不练。
    2. 代码实战练习:使用在线编程平台(如LeetCode、牛客网)下载配套练习题,强化编码能力。
    3. 跟踪更新内容:关注Java新特性(如Java 17的Sealed类、模式匹配),下载最新版教程以保持技术同步。
    4. 分阶段学习:将教程拆分为基础、进阶、高阶模块,逐步深入,避免信息过载。
    5. 笔记与总结:下载教程后整理笔记,用思维导图或代码片段归纳知识点,提升记忆效率。
  4. 避免常见陷阱的注意事项

    java编程教程下载
    1. 警惕盗版资源:下载非官方渠道的教程可能涉及版权问题,建议通过正规平台获取,或使用开源资源。
    2. 防止信息过时:Java技术更新频繁,需优先选择定期维护的教程,例如官方文档或知名博主的更新内容。
    3. 注意版本兼容性:下载教程时确认Java版本(如JDK 8、JDK 11),避免因版本差异导致学习障碍。
    4. 避免碎片化学习:选择结构完整的教程体系,例如从基础语法到高级设计模式的分册资源,确保知识连贯。
    5. 善用工具辅助:下载教程后使用IDE工具(如IntelliJ IDEA)或在线调试平台(如JDoodle)进行实践,提升学习效果。
  5. 如何利用下载的教程资源

    1. 制定学习计划:根据教程目录规划每日学习任务,例如完成一个章节后进行相关练习,避免盲目下载。
    2. 做笔记与总结:对教程中的关键概念(如多线程、异常处理)进行标注,形成个人知识库。
    3. 加入学习社群:通过教程附带的社区链接或论坛(如Stack Overflow)交流问题,获取实时帮助。
    4. 定期复习与测试:利用教程中的习题和案例进行自我检测,巩固所学内容。
    5. 分享与反馈:将学习成果整理成文档或视频分享给他人,通过教学深化理解,同时获得反馈优化学习路径。


Java编程教程下载并非简单的文件获取,而是系统化学习的关键环节,选择权威资源、注重实践应用、避免信息陷阱,才能高效掌握Java技术,建议结合自身需求,灵活运用多种资源,并通过持续学习和实践实现技能提升。优质教程是通往编程精通的阶梯,合理利用才能事半功倍。

扫描二维码推送至手机访问。

版权声明:本文由码界编程网发布,如需转载请注明出处。

本文链接:http://b2b.dropc.cn/cxxt/23110.html

分享给朋友:

“java编程教程下载,Java编程教程大全下载合集” 的相关文章

match多列查找,多列匹配查询技巧

match多列查找,多列匹配查询技巧

“match多列查找”是指在数据库查询中,通过匹配多个列的条件来筛选数据,这种方法常用于复杂查询,通过联合多个列的值来确定记录的匹配情况,从而提高查询的精确度和效率,在实现时,通常需要构建一个复合条件,该条件结合了多个列的比较操作,如等于、大于、小于等,以达到在大量数据中快速定位特定记录的目的。理解...

linux从入门到精通,Linux系统从新手到高手全面指南

linux从入门到精通,Linux系统从新手到高手全面指南

《Linux从入门到精通》是一本全面介绍Linux操作系统的书籍,从基础的安装配置到高级的系统管理,再到系统编程和网络应用,内容丰富,讲解清晰,本书适合Linux初学者逐步掌握Linux知识,同时也能为有一定基础的读者提供更深入的指导,通过系统学习,读者可以全面了解Linux系统,提高系统管理和应用...

cssci是什么级别的论文,CSSCI论文在学术界的影响力及级别探讨

cssci是什么级别的论文,CSSCI论文在学术界的影响力及级别探讨

CSSCI,即中国社会科学引文索引,是中国学术期刊评价的重要标准之一,它代表了国内社会科学领域的权威性,收录了众多知名学术期刊,CSSCI级别的论文通常具有较高的学术价值,代表着作者的研究成果在学术界得到了广泛的认可,CSSCI级别的论文在国内学术界具有较高地位。CSSCI是什么级别的论文? 用户...

java虚拟机运行什么文件,Java虚拟机运行.class文件

java虚拟机运行什么文件,Java虚拟机运行.class文件

Java虚拟机(JVM)运行的是以.class为扩展名的Java字节码文件,这些文件是Java源代码编译后的结果,包含了指令集和运行时数据,JVM负责将这些字节码文件加载到内存中,执行其中的指令,实现Java程序的多平台运行。Java虚拟机运行什么文件? 用户解答: 嗨,我最近在学习Java,有...

免费的编程网站,探索免费编程资源,精选在线学习平台

免费的编程网站,探索免费编程资源,精选在线学习平台

这是一个提供免费编程资源的网站,涵盖编程语言学习、在线编辑器、教程和社区交流等功能,用户可以在此平台上免费学习编程知识,使用代码编辑器进行实践,同时还能参与社区讨论,提升编程技能,网站旨在为编程初学者和爱好者提供一个便捷的学习环境。用户提问:我想学习编程,但预算有限,有没有免费的编程网站推荐? 解...

房地产网站源码,房地产网站源码,专业开发资源汇总

房地产网站源码,房地产网站源码,专业开发资源汇总

房地产网站源码是指包含房地产信息展示、交易、搜索等功能的网站代码,这些源码通常由HTML、CSS、JavaScript等前端技术以及服务器端语言(如PHP、Python、Java等)编写而成,通过购买或获取这些源码,用户可以快速搭建自己的房地产交易平台,实现房源发布、在线咨询、预约看房等业务,满足房...